Main Features and Details

The MGA licensing process involves several key components that contribute to its effectiveness. Firstly, operators must undergo a rigorous application process that includes background checks, financial assessments, and the submission of detailed business plans. This ensures that only reputable companies are granted licenses. Secondly, the MGA mandates regular audits and compliance checks to ensure ongoing adherence to regulations. This includes monitoring gaming outcomes to guarantee fairness and the implementation of measures to protect player data and funds. Additionally, the MGA promotes responsible gaming practices, requiring operators to provide tools for self-exclusion and limits on deposits.

Practical Examples and Use Cases

To illustrate the impact of MGA licensing, consider a scenario where a player experiences a dispute regarding a payout. In a licensed MGA casino, the player has access to a clear and transparent dispute resolution process, which is overseen by the authority. This process not only protects the player but also holds the casino accountable for its operations. Furthermore, in cases where operators fail to comply with MGA regulations, the authority has the power to impose penalties or revoke licenses, thereby ensuring that only compliant operators remain in the market. This creates a safer environment for players and enhances the overall reputation of the online gaming industry.

Advantages and Disadvantages

While MGA licensing offers numerous advantages, such as enhanced player protection and increased trust, there are also some disadvantages to consider. On the positive side, players can feel secure knowing that they are playing in a regulated environment where their rights are protected. This can lead to increased player retention and loyalty for operators. However, the licensing process can be lengthy and costly for operators, which may deter smaller companies from entering the market. Additionally, some players may feel that the regulations are too stringent, limiting their gaming options. Balancing these factors is crucial for the continued growth of the online casino industry.
